Workforce Training for Sustainable Local Businesses
Workforce training initiatives represent a critical investment in economically challenged communities. This funding program specifically targets areas such as small towns and villages, aiming to enhance local employment prospects by addressing existing skill gaps in vital industries like agriculture, tourism, and manufacturing. By creating tailored training sessions that align with the needs of local small businesses, the program supports the development of a more competent workforce. This initiative spans multiple sectors, focusing on providing skills that correlate directly with local business demands, thereby promoting self-sufficiency within the community.
Concrete use cases illustrate the potential impact of this funding. For example, a rural town might experience stagnation in its agricultural sector due to outdated farming techniques. With a workforce training program, local farmers can receive training on modern, sustainable practices, leading to increased productivity and higher market value for their produce. Similarly, a small coastal village reliant on tourism could implement hospitality training for its residents. This would not only enhance service quality but also create an avenue for local employment, with residents better equipped to cater to visitors' needs, ultimately boosting the local economy.
Organizations eligible for this funding include local workforce development boards, educational institutions, and community non-profits that have established partnerships with small businesses. These entities play a pivotal role in delivering relevant training and ensuring that course curricula align with employer needs. Conversely, private for-profit entities, while crucial to local economies, are generally ineligible since the funding is specifically aimed at non-profit educational endeavors that emphasize community development.
Alignment factors for this funding include a demonstrable need for workforce training within the targeted community, as evidenced by local employment rates and business surveys. Moreover, successful applications should highlight a clear strategy for collaboration between local businesses and training providers to ensure programs are responsive to real-time industry demands. It's crucial that applicants articulate how the training will enhance the skillsets of participants and, by extension, the overall business environment in their locality.
